Yet another episode that didn't increase the story but so much, but I liked it a lot more because it at least gave us a lot of backstory that like a lot of commenters I thought it might leave deliberately vague. The answers we got were pretty confusing and strange though. As expected and had actually previously been confirmed Akio was once Dios. Anthy became The Rose Bride after being sentenced to a horrible fate trying to save her brother from spending all of his life energy helping local girls/princesses. Utena saw Anthy in her miserable predicament and this is what inspired her to make her pledge to become a Prince. To me there are still questions. What was Dios doing to all of these girls? Was it actually positive/necessary? And above all when will Utena finally remember what we learn in this episode?

I really liked the inclusion of the real life (in the universe of the series) Shadow Players in this episode. They are one of my favorite parts of a show I love a lot of things about, and it was nice that they were in focus in this episode after being conspicuously absent last time. It was an interesting meta set up that they approach Utena to join their club with free tickets to one of their shows. And I got a chuckle that we still got an aside with them even after the fact and they were amusingly celebrating the performance.

I think these past two episodes which have slowed the pace down slightly, while still having some exciting revelations have been necessary to the buildup of the big finale. Still I'm eager to see the series get it in gear, and at the risk of seeming pettily critical I'm impatient for Utena to finally remember/realize just what's been going on.

So, Dios literally was the light of the world who saved everyone and made all the girls princesses. The people became overly dependent upon him and heavily overworked him to the brink of death, at which point his sister intervened to save his life. The people "killed" her and placed her in a state of eternal suffering as a result.

Meanwhile... Dios actually did become sealed away? This is the part the flashback didn't back clear. Dios wasn't actually sealed when Anthy was speared... So somehow his spirit/soul was acually sealed away and his body became what is now End of the World, Akio, and Anthy is left with nothing but torment in both states.

Utena encountered the spirit of Dios somehow, who told her the story and gave her a means of reversing the situation.

This still leaves a lot of major questions. After thinking about it more, here are my theories:

1. Utena existence appears to be separate from that of Dios and Anthy. That is, although the world she inhabited as a child had already fallen into darkness, it was still the real world. Although the question of how Anthy is existing in two different states simultaneously arises (and I'll address it more explicitly further down), I don't believe Anthy's problem is one that can be solved internally, by her own mind. She would have to be saved by an external force, necessitating that Utena's world is the real world.

2. I think what was sealed away in order to keep Anthy alive was part of Dios's and Anthy's wills, which is what led to the current perversions of their personalities. Nearly the entirety of Anthy's will was sealed away, leaving her in the near-empty state she exists in now, and all of Dios's morals and most of his power was sealed away, which is why he as he exists in the castle seems to hate End of the World.

That could be completely wrong, and I'm still not sure what End of the World's true motives are even if it is, but that's the gist I got from this episode.
